Item #: SCP-XXXX
Object Class: Safe
Special Containment Procedures: SCP-XXXX is to be kept in a 10x10x10 feet room. SCP-XXXX must be supported at 3 feet above the ground by a metal rod with an openably claw attached to the end. SCP-XXXX needs to the fixated by the claw between the two "bulb" parts of the object.
Description: SCP-XXXX is a glass object in the form of two tear-shaped hollow bulbs connected by their thin ends to each other. The glass is an approximate 0,15 inch thick at every point in the object and seemingly slightly more robust than traditional glass, although it has not been observed under high amounts of stress yet.
SCP-XXXX's anomalous properties activate once a the bulb come into contact with any object. After 2 seconds of touching the surface of said object, the bulb will fill with a liquid with the exact same colour of the surface of the object through anomalous means. Tests have revealed the viscosity to be similar to that of water.
When touching any other surface with a full bulb, that surface and any neighbouring surface with an edge higher than 90° will immediately adopt the colour of the liquid in said bulb.
The liquid inside the bulb can be disposed of turning SCP-XXXX so that the full bulb is placed over the empty one. After roughly 2.5 seconds the bulb will empty anomalously.
However, when both bulbs are filled with liquids of different colour, turning SCP-XXXX will result in the upper bulb emptying inside the lower bulb, creating a colour that is a perfect cromatic mixture of both.
SCP-XXXX has shown to posess slightly memetic properties when used by an individual. After roughly 2 minutes of individuals learning the properties of SCP-XXXX all subjects have been observed using them in a playful manner, colouring each wall of the room differently and changing their uniforms tones. After 10 minutes, most subjects gain knowledge on how to use SCP-XXXX more accurately, allowing them to draw singular lines and shapes instead of colouring entire surfaces. Subjects were not able to describe how they did this, nor did they remember any of the techniques after using SCP-XXXX
